Trip Overview

The drive from Overland Park, KS to Syracuse, KS covers 428.3 miles and takes about 8h 6m behind the wheel. It usually feels better as a 2-day road trip than as one long push.

The route leans on US 56, Truman/Eisenhower Presidential Highway, US 50 for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is highway-focused dr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 118.4 miles on US 56. At current regular gas prices, budget about $66.96 one way before food or hotel costs.

Turn-by-Turn Driving Directions

Step-by-step road directions between Overland Park, KS and Syracuse, KS.

1

Start on this road

134 ft · 13 sec · this road
2

Turn right onto West 81st Street

182 ft · 12 sec · West 81st Street
3

Turn left onto Marty Street

482 ft · 23 sec · Marty Street
4

Turn right onto West 80th Street

0.1 mi · 35 sec · West 80th Street
5

Turn left onto Metcalf Avenue

3.8 mi · 6 min · Metcalf Avenue
Use the left / straight / right lanes.
6

Keep slight left at fork onto I 635

4.7 mi · 5 min · Harry Darby Memorial Highway
Use the straight lane.
7

Take the exit

0.3 mi · 41 sec
Exit 4B Toward I 70 West: Topeka Use the slight left lane.
8

Merge onto I 70; US 24; US 40

51 mi · 51 min · Kansas Turnpike
Use the straight / slight right lanes.
9

Keep slight right at fork onto I 70

0.9 mi · 1 min · Kansas Turnpike
Toward I-70 West, US 40 West: Topeka, Salina Use the slight left / slight right lanes.
10

Continue on I 70

92 mi · 1 hr 34 min · Truman/Eisenhower Presidential Highway
Toward I-70 West Use the straight lane.
11

Continue on I 70; US 40

49 mi · 49 min · Dwight D. Eisenhower Highway
12

Take the exit

0.2 mi · 28 sec
Toward KS 156, Ellsworth, Great Bend
13

Turn left onto KS 156

48 mi · 56 min · KS 156
14

Take the ramp onto KS 156

3.8 mi · 6 min · KS 156
15

Turn left onto US 281

0.4 mi · 38 sec · Main Street
16

Turn right onto Railroad Avenue

0.6 mi · 1 min · Railroad Avenue
17

Turn left onto Railroad Avenue

2.1 mi · 5 min · Railroad Avenue
18

At end of road, turn left onto US 56; KS 156

118 mi · 2 hr 22 min · US 56; KS 156
19

Turn right onto East Mary Street

0.4 mi · 58 sec · East Mary Street
20

Take the ramp

0.4 mi · 49 sec
21

Turn straight onto US 50; US 83; US 400

19 mi · 22 min · US 50; US 83; US 400
22

Continue on US 50; US 400

33 mi · 39 min · US 50; US 400
23

Turn left onto Barber Street

139 ft · 6 sec · Barber Street
24

Arrive at destination

Barber Street
